Abstract

The invention provides a load balancing method for a heterogeneous wireless network, which comprises the steps of: 1, generating a population, wherein the population comprises a plurality of individuals, and each individual is used for indicating each user in a wireless network range whether to access a cell; and 2, executing a genetic algorithm on the population so as to generate a population which meets the population fitness requirement. The method further comprises the steps of: executing an annealing algorithm on the population so as to generate a population which meets the annealing fitness requirement. According to the method provided by the invention, by increasing a selection probability of poor-quality population individuals, a probability of selecting a locally optimal solution is reduced, and algorithm complexity is reduced to a certain degree.

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to wireless communication, in particular to communication of heterogeneous wireless networks. Background technique [0002] With the full popularity of smart terminals and the rapid development of the mobile Internet, the proportion of data services in wireless communications is increasing. Faced with huge demand for data service traffic, mobile operators are worrying about the increased data traffic. Carriers analyze that offloading mobile data can greatly improve the utilization of wireless spectrum resources. The 3G / 4G standard protocol already supports low-power small base stations. Deploying low-power nodes as a supplement to macro base stations can double the available spectrum resources per unit area of ​​the area, thereby improving service throughput.
